A Survivor's Story: Ashley

It’s survivor stories that serve as lessons for others who have experienced gender-based and/or intimate partner violence.

“I believe all of [this] has made me the strong person I am today, and now allows me to help others get out of situations I wish I could have had help getting out of.”

Those are the words said today by an amazing adult woman whose abuse story began at a very young age.

She was molested and human trafficked by her foster brother at the young age of 4 and 5.

She was molested everyday at age 13-14 by her mom’s best friend. She took the abuser to court - who was sentenced to two (2) years but got out early for “good behaviour” !!!!!

In her early twenties she was ruffied at a bar, then taken advantage of by multiple guys in the bar bathroom while security stood around and didn’t do anything.

She has also overcome emotional abuse in a same sex relationship.

Her name is Ashley. She is a survivor and is proud to be a member of the SAFE Committee. She bravely shares her story in the hopes to help others victims of abuse and GBV.

SAFE is honoured in having Ashley as a key member of the SAFE Committee.
